The electrical voltage and socket types used on board cruise ships can vary depending upon the cruise line and point of origin, however, ships are usually fitted with standard US, European or UK sockets or a mixture of these.
Standard electrical supply in the United Kingdom operates at 240V and three-pin UK sockets on cruise ships operate at 220V or 230V volts which should be sufficient for charging electrical equipment like laptops and mobile phones.
Most cabins should also be fitted with a hairdryer and a standard electrical shaver charger.
You will find that most cruise lines have European or American sockets onboard with the exception of P&O Cruises. The P&O fleet operates with standard UK three-pin plug sockets with the exception of P&O Britannia which also has US two- pin sockets in addition to the UK three- pin ones.
